This is where the Fediverse comes in.

The Fediverse is a decentralized network of social media platforms that allows users to connect and communicate without relying on a central authority or corporation. Fediverse platforms like Mastodon, Pleroma, and Pixelfed are open-source, community-driven, and respect users’ privacy and autonomy. They allow you to create your own instance, with its own rules, policies, and community, and federate with other instances to form a broader network of users.

This is particularly useful for communities like churches, where privacy, trust, and a sense of belonging are crucial. Setting up a Fediverse instance for your church can provide numerous benefits, such as:

  1. Privacy: With a Fediverse instance, you have complete control over your data and your community’s privacy. You can set your own privacy policies, control who can join your instance, and decide which data is shared with other instances. This can help build trust and a sense of security among your community members.
  2. Autonomy: With a Fediverse instance, you have complete autonomy over your platform. You can customize the look and feel of your instance, set your own rules and policies, and moderate content according to your community’s standards. This can help create a sense of ownership and participation among your community members.
  3. Community building: A Fediverse instance can help your church community connect and communicate in new ways. You can create dedicated spaces for different groups or topics, share resources, and facilitate discussions and events. This can help build a stronger sense of community and belonging among your members.
  4. Accessibility: A Fediverse instance is open-source and accessible, meaning that anyone can use it regardless of their platform or device. This can help ensure that your community members can access your platform regardless of their personal circumstances.
  5. Sustainability: A Fediverse instance is community-driven and sustainable, meaning that it is not dependent on a central authority or corporation. This can help ensure that your platform is reliable, secure, and able to serve your community in the long run.

Setting up a Fediverse instance for your church may seem like a daunting task, but it is relatively easy and inexpensive. Platforms like Mastodon and Pleroma have detailed documentation and supportive communities that can guide you through the process. You can also work with a developer or a hosting provider to set up and maintain your instance.
